ABOUT The Grip

The Grip Jar Opener was invented in 1977 under a different name (the Lid Persuader) by our grandfather who was an aspiring entrepreneur from Oklahoma who saw a clear need for a tool to help people open stubborn lids effortlessly.

The first 20,000 were made in wood, and in 1982 we began manufacturing them in a solid mold injected plastic. Over the next few decades our product was sold through church and civics groups, the Helping Hand campaign through Oral Roberts University, and even featured on national television on the TBN network.
